Output 51034279eb872a85533004b7e0ca104cadf0491da87d56d8aaa35e0e7f49c278:167

value
7323480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f7d6221f9421b986c40c746644d1addba10853 OP_EQUAL
address
3FdqXgT4jr7YrkDEHsdcn7pXb7nFFBFNX5
transaction
51034279eb872a85533004b7e0ca104cadf0491da87d56d8aaa35e0e7f49c278
spent
true